English Translation
It was narrated from Abu Hurayra (رضي الله عنه) — via Hammad ibn Usama, from Hisham, from his father — that the Messenger of Allah ﷺ said: "A woman was punished because of a cat that she confined until it died of hunger. She neither fed it nor released it to eat from the insects of the earth. And a man was forgiven for removing a thorny branch from the road."
